Item 1.01.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On May 31, 2017, Dorian LPG Ltd. (the "Company") entered into an Amendment No. 2 (the "Bank Amendment") to the $758 million facility agreement originally dated March 23, 2015, as amended, by and among Dorian LPG Finance LLC, as borrower, the Company, as facility guarantor, certain wholly-owned subsidiaries of the Company as upstream guarantors, ABN Amro Capital USA LLC, Citibank N.A., London Branch, ING Bank N.V., London Branch, and DVB Bank SE, as bookrunners, and the lenders party to the agreement (the "2015 Debt Facility").
Key amendments to the 2015 Debt Facility as part of the Bank Amendment are as follows:
Liquidity
$26.8 million of restricted cash has been released to the Company to prepay debt, interest and certain fees. $24.8 million of the released restricted cash will be applied to the next two debt principal payments.  The Company has agreed to recontribute $22.0 million to the restricted cash account over the next 12 months, unless it completes a common stock offering with net proceeds of at least $50.0 million, in which case the Company will be required to maintain a minimum of at least 5% of the total principal amount of the facility in the restricted cash account.
In addition, the maximum level of minimum liquidity has been permanently reduced to $40.0 million, and the definition thereof has also been expanded for one year to capture other cash balances previously excluded.
Relaxation of Certain Covenants
Minimum interest coverage ratio of consolidated EBITDA to consolidated net interest expense shall be reduced from 2.00x to 1.25x for the twelve months ending March 31, 2018 and to 1.50x for the twelve months ending March 31, 2019. Thereafter, the covenant shall revert to the previously agreed level of 2.50x.
Minimum value (the ratio of the value of the pledged vessels to the outstanding debt) has also been amended to 125% for the twelve months ending March 31, 2018 and 130% for the twelve months ending March 31, 2019. Thereafter, the covenant shall revert to the previously agreed level of 135%. 
Other Amendments
In the event that the Company completes a common stock offering with net proceeds of at least $50 million, limitations related to the Company's ability to declare dividends and repurchase shares of Company stock, as introduced in the Bank Amendment, will be eliminated, and the minimum liquidity requirement will be further decreased.  In any event, such limitation on dividends and share repurchases will terminate two years from the date of the Bank Amendment.
The Company paid to the lenders a $1 million fee in connection with the Bank Amendment.
